ADC Differential Pi Articles & Tutorials

The ADC Differential Pi is an 8-channel 18-bit analogue to digital converter designed to work with the Raspberry Pi and other compatible single-board computers. The ADC Differential Pi is based on two Microchip MCP3424 A/D converters, each containing 4 analogue inputs. The MCP3424 is a delta-sigma A/D converter with low noise differential inputs.

This knowledge base section contains articles and tutorials on the ADC Differential Pi, showing how to use the expansion board with various input devices.
